Arla Foods Targets Gamers With New Drinks Concept

Arla Foods Ingredients, a global leader in improving premium nutrition, has launched a high-protein concept targeting gamers who want to level up their nutrition - introducing the 'PROGAMER'.

The ready-to-drink solution is designed to meet the needs of e-sports enthusiasts seeking benefits for their health as well as their gaming performance. It's ingredients profile is tailored to target improved concentration and vision, with 15g of protein, including 3767mg of branched-chain amino acids, plus taurine, magnesium, zinc, caffeine and vitamins A, B3, B6 and B12.

Cido Silveira, Arla Foods Ingredients Marketing & Business Development Manager – South America, said: "There's a stereotype of gamers bingeing on unhealthy snacks and guzzling down energy drinks, but a new, nutrition-focused generation is emerging. They want to maintain their energy and concentration levels over marathon sessions, but they also want the many benefits that high-protein products offer. PROGAMER allows manufacturers to formulate unique, refreshing, clear, high-protein solutions for gamers who want more from their energy drinks."

The brand quotes research found that highlights improvements in attention and cognitive flexibility from the consumption of essential amino acids, as well as a study on esports athletes which showed that sufficient protein intake is associated with improved cognitive performance in gaming.

The new RTD canned drink was showcased at NIS (the Nutri Ingredients Summit) in São Paulo, Brazil this month ahead of going on general sale.
